Overview of the Intel Nuc 13 Pro
The Intel Nuc 13 Pro is a mini PC designed for high performance in a compact form factor. It features the latest 13th generation Intel processors, integrated Iris Xe graphics, and support for advanced gaming features. Its small size makes it ideal for gamers who want a portable yet powerful system.
Testing Methodology
Performance testing was conducted using a selection of popular modern titles, including Cyberpunk 2077, Call of Duty: Warzone, Fortnite, and Assassin’s Creed Valhalla. The tests measured FPS at 1080p resolution with high settings, which is typical for gaming on compact systems.
Hardware Configuration
- Intel Core i7-13th Gen Processor
- 16GB DDR5 RAM
- Intel Iris Xe Graphics
- 512GB NVMe SSD
- Windows 11 OS
FPS Results for Modern Titles
The following FPS averages were observed during gameplay, providing a benchmark for performance expectations.
Cyberpunk 2077
Cyberpunk 2077, known for its demanding graphics, ran at an average of 45 FPS. While not ultra-smooth, gameplay remained playable with minor adjustments to graphics settings.
Call of Duty: Warzone
In Warzone, the Nuc 13 Pro achieved an average of 70 FPS. This performance allows for competitive gameplay with minimal lag.
Fortnite
Fortnite, being less demanding, ran at an impressive 120 FPS on high settings, providing a smooth gaming experience.
Assassin’s Creed Valhalla
This open-world title ran at an average of 50 FPS, which is acceptable for exploration and combat, though some players might prefer lower settings for higher FPS.
